Fresca (San Francisco California)

Peruvian food, anyone? Bored with all the hamburgers you’ve been wolfing down during your San Francisco bus tour holiday trip? Well, here’s an idea….why not go a little exotic and head on over to Fresca, which is one of San Francisco’s best bus tour dining destinations. It’s right on my top 10 list of best restaurants in the country. Even if you’re not a fan of Peruvian food, you’ll find something to eat there, don’t worry. Actually, come to think of it, there are no other Peruvian restaurants in San Francisco that comes close, so, if you’re ever in San Francisco for a bus tour holiday, be sure to make a stop here!

There aren’t many complaints about this wonderful San Francisco restaurant except for two. One, it would be great if they had more space or opened up outside. And two, the pricing is a little on the high side. But if you don’t mind spending a little bit of money on absolutely mouth-watering Peruvian cuisine…then this bus tour stop is a MUST.

What’s really lovely about this San Francisco restaurant is the environment. Although lacking in space, I love their wooden tables and flooring concept – it makes the dining experience so….unique! And of course, you’ll get to watch the action behind the camera…er…KITCHEN with their open-door kitchen concept. And you’re really missing out if you’ve never tried Latin beers! Something that will truly open up your eyes wide. A nice mug to down the delicious food is going to complete your night. If you decide to make a bus tour stop here, don’t forget to try out their Ceviche which is nothing short of divine while their Pescado a lo Macho is another to-die-for dish! During your San Francisco bus tour stop at Fresca, try, also, the papa rellena and the lenguado con risotto. Sounds alien to you? Don’t worry, if you’re not familiar with the food names, just ask the pleasant waiters there.

For a totally mind-blowing meal, head on over to Fresca of San Francisco and your bus tour holiday trip is a guaranteed surprise. Fresca is at 2114 Fillmore St, San Francisco, CA 94115-2224. For details, call +1 415 447 2668 and they’re open 11am till 10pm from Mondays through to Saturday. On Sundays, Fresca open for business from 11am till 9pm.
